What Draft Polisher does

Draft Polisher edits `output/DRAFT.md` to remove boilerplate, improve coherence, and keep citations anchored to the evidence. Use it when a first-pass draft reads like scaffolding or needs a final polishing pass before review.

Draft Polisher (Audit-style editing)

Goal: turn a first-pass draft into readable survey prose without breaking the evidence contract.

This is a local polish pass: de-template + coherence + terminology + redundancy pruning.

Note: if the main issue is structural redundancy from section accumulation, push the change upstream to sections/ and use paragraph-curator before merge. draft-polisher should not be the primary place where you decide which paragraphs to keep.

Role cards (use explicitly)

Style Harmonizer (editor)

Mission: remove generator voice and make prose read like one author wrote it.
